Check the tops of all your doors and make sure they are SEALED. Half mine aren't, huge pain come Winter and all the moisture makes them grow and they get completely stuck. Physically can't open my front doors. Check your floor tiles are nice and flat, no tiles sticking up causing a tripping hazard. Check the underneath of your stone bench is polished and not covered in writing. If it is, not sure what you can do about it really, but make them polish it. Love your ensuite.
